"Biri Ka Mbiri" is one of Chief Oliver De Coque's most beloved songs. The track, which translates to "My Friend" in English, showcases De Coque's storytelling ability and his knack for crafting infectious melodies. The song has become a timeless classic, with its memorable guitar riff and catchy chorus continuing to captivate listeners of all ages.
The impact of "Biri Ka Mbiri" on Nigerian music cannot be overstated. The song has influenced countless musicians across genres, and its legacy continues to inspire new artists. De Coque's innovative fusion of traditional Igbo music with modern styles paved the way for future generations of Nigerian musicians. The title "Biri Ka Mbiri" is an Igbo idiom that roughly translates to "Let the world be" or "Live and let live." It is a philosophical stance on tolerance and the acceptance of others.
